55 Marietta Street,
tvbauer
wrote
15 years ago:
The building is not built atop an underground river and the parking levels do not require pumps. The Building was purchased by a private investment group, Bank Building Limited Partnership, in the early 1990's, and they continue to own the property. The building was never donated to Georgia Stete University. 55 Marietta serves as home to numerous telecom companies due to the abundant fiber network placed in Marietta Street for the 1996 Olympics. The building is being substantially renovated in 2010 and the management office will qualify for LEED designation.
